C4 Prop V3 & Bugs
Monday, 22 March 2010 22:46

 

The code in the download section labeled "Bomb_sketch6" has a major bug that prevents the code from running correctly with some hardware (more specifics later). If you were using that version and experienced problems, please update to v1.5.

Version 3 of the C4 Prop is now completed. The new design loses the tether, and instead "chirps" once per minute (like the Counterstrike version) It is also now fully contained in a larger grey plastic project box, rather than the standard ammo can (but it will still fit in the medium sized ammo can). This served several purposes. First, it lowers the shipping weight considerably; second, it reduces the price by about $8; third, it allows me to make the unit "water resistant". The newest version of the code (1.6.1) also removed the additional push button used for the disarm interrupt. To disarm, you now just press the "#" on the keypad.

1.6.1 Changes: (DOWNLOAD HERE)

-Removed pushbutton used for interrupt

-added chirp at 1 minute intervals (every time the counter hits 30 seconds)

 

1.6.0 Changes: (DOWNLOAD HERE)

-Removed tether

-updated to the newest keypad library

-streamlined disarm code and count down

-fixed some LCD glitches, created new ones.

Bomb Prop V2 Finished
Friday, 08 January 2010 12:22

 

I finally got around to correcting all the problems with the original idea and created a new prototype.

Change log:

-Fixed low volume buzzer
-timer now correctly removes 15 seconds when less than 15 is left on the countdown.
-Tether has been beefed up to prevent tampering
-more reliable solid state relay for buzzer.
- now uses an atmega168 without the Arduino.

 

The use of the atmega160 allows me to cut almost $40 off the total cost to build this, which will be reflected in the new price. The new tether is more secure and not as "touchy" as the previous version was, I still wouldn't recommend yanking on it, but it should be safe if someone trips over it.
